WordPress provides a wide range of tools for creating dynamic websites for different purposes and recipients, and if you want to take your WordPress website to a higher level and enter the lucrative world of eCommerce, look no further than the powerful WooCommerce tool.
WooCommerce allows you to quickly and elegantly implement e-commerce solutions directly on your WordPress site in a highly-customizable way. WooCommerce is an open-source WordPress plugin with full documentation that allows a small business to start selling products online.
